Installation 

1

.  All Accurate Thermal Systems units are supplied with a power cable. 

2

. Before connecting the power supply, check the voltage against the rating plate. Connect the power 

    cable to a suitable plug according to the table below. Note that the unit must be earth grounded 
    to ensure proper electrical safety. 
 
    Electrical connections: 

220V-240V  

110V-120V 

    Live    

 

   Brown  

    Black 

    Neutral  

 

   Blue    

    White 

    Earth ground   

Green/yellow  

    Green 

 
    The fused plug supplied with the power lead for use in the UK is fitted with the following value fuse to      
    protect the cable: 230V UK 4 AMP 
    The fuse in the unit protects the unit and the operator 
    Note that units marked 230V on the rating plate work at 220V; units marked 120V work at 110V. In     
    both cases, however, the heating rate will degrade by approximately 8%. The rating plate is on the   
    rear of the unit. 

3

. Plug the power cable into the socket on the rear of the unit. 

4

. Place the unit on a suitable bench or flat workspace, or in a fume cupboard if required, ensuring that  

    the air inlet vents on the underside are free from obstruction. 
    After use, when you have finished heating samples, remember that parts of the unit may be very hot.     
    Take the precautions listed earlier.
